Can a music CD be copied?

When you rip music from a CD, you’re copying songs from an audio CD to your PC. During the ripping process, the Player compresses each song and stores it on your drive as a Windows Media Audio (WMA), WAV, or MP3 file.

Is handbrake illegal?

Under the 1998 Digital Millennium Copyright Act, it’s generally illegal to distribute hardware or software — such as the DVD-decoding software Handbrake available from a server in France — that can “circumvent” copy protection technology.

What is a video ripper?

A DVD ripper is a computer program that facilitates copying the content of a DVD to a hard disk drive. They are mainly used to transfer video on DVDs to different formats, to edit or back up DVD content, and to convert DVD video for playback on media players and mobile devices.

Why is it called burning a DVD?

Burning Means Writing a Recordable CD with a Laser
The process is often called “burning” because a laser in the CD-R drive uses heat to record the data to the disc.

Why do we say burn a CD?

The reason the term “burn” is used is because the CD-writer, or burner, literally burns the data onto a writable CD. The laser in a CD-writer can be cranked up to a more powerful level than an ordinary CD-ROM laser.So that is why people talk about “burning” songs or files to CDs.
